In the simplest terms, phlebotomy is the removal of blood from the body using a needle and some form of collection apparatus. The process is performed thousands of times daily in big medical facilities and is delegated to a group of people who specialize in gathering and processing specimens. Within the rapidly expanding health care industry, employment of clinical lab technicians (which includes phlebotomists) is anticipated to increase 14 percent from 2006 to 2016--faster compared to the average for all occupations. The increase in new jobs is due to rising population and the development of new laboratory tests.
